Apple recommends that you operate with at least 25% free hard disk space. That's because it does all sorts of things with that space. On a MacBook Air, maintaining free space is always a challenge.

I'm not familiar with Omnidisksweeper, but when it reports a file with size 192GB on a MacBook Air, you know that whatever your problem is, it's serious! Is your drive 80 or 120GB? I suspect Kaveman's on the right track, something is very wrong with your hard drive.

Make a thorough backup of your files. Get a brand new good quality external drive, and run a complete Time Machine backup. Then take it to a qualified Mac specialist and get them to investigate.
